What Is The Present Size Of The Capillary Blood Collection Devices Market And What Value Is Projected For 2029?
The market size for capillary blood collection devices has seen rapid expansion in recent years. It is projected to increase from $2.41 billion in 2024 to $2.72 billion in 2025, demonstrating a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 12.7%. The growth observed in the historic period can be attributed to increased awareness of disease screening, a rise in home healthcare, an expanding geriatric population, an increased focus on preventive medicine, and the broader expansion of infectious disease testing.
The market for capillary blood collection devices is projected to experience substantial expansion over the upcoming years. By 2029, this market is anticipated to reach a valuation of $4.29 billion, advancing at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 12.1%. This anticipated growth during the forecast period stems from factors such as a growing inclination towards point-of-care testing, an increase in chronic disease occurrences, the escalating need for remote patient monitoring, a heightened focus on preventive healthcare, and greater public awareness concerning infectious diseases. Key trends identified for the forecast period encompass point of care testing, continuous technological advancements, microfluidics applications, the rise of personalized medicine, and the expansion of remote patient monitoring.

What Factors Are Boosting The Capillary Blood Collection Devices Market?
The escalating incidence of chronic illnesses is anticipated to fuel the expansion of the capillary blood collection devices market moving ahead. These are prolonged health conditions requiring continuous management and therapeutic interventions. The growing occurrence of chronic diseases stems from various elements like an aging demographic, poor lifestyle choices, environmental influences, and improved medical diagnostic techniques facilitating earlier disease identification. Such devices empower both patients and medical professionals to manage chronic conditions more effectively through regular, convenient, and minimally invasive blood tests, resulting in enhanced patient well-being and life quality. As an illustration, data from December 2023, sourced from the Australian Bureau Statistics, an independent national statistical office in Australia, indicated that in 2022, approximately 49.9% of Australians disclosed having at least one chronic condition. Among these, the prevalent issues encompassed mental and behavioral disorders (26.1%), back problems (15.7%), and arthritis (14.5%). Roughly 81.4% of Australians, equivalent to about 20.7 million people, reported experiencing at least one long-term health condition. Furthermore, a report from April 2024 by Allergy UK, a national charity based in the UK, revealed that over 21 million individuals in the UK suffer from allergies, which emerged as the most frequently reported chronic health condition in 2022. Forecasts suggest that by 2026, half of Europe’s population will be affected by at least one allergy. Consequently, the escalating incidence of chronic diseases acts as a catalyst for the expansion of the capillary blood collection devices market.

Which Emerging Trends Are Reshaping The Capillary Blood Collection Devices Market Landscape?
Leading companies in the capillary blood collection devices market are prioritizing the development of innovative products, such as neonatal and pediatric capillary blood sampling devices, to address particular requirements and overcome challenges in healthcare settings focused on infants and young children. For example, in October 2023, Owen Mumford Ltd., a medical device company based in the UK, introduced Unistik Heelstik, a range of capillary blood sampling solutions for neonates and children. This series features four blood sample instruments, each specifically designed for a distinct developmental stage: Unistik Heelstik Toddler, Full Term, Preemie, and Micro Preemie. These devices aim to resolve the difficulties of capillary blood sampling in newborns and older babies to ensure sufficient sample volumes are obtained while minimizing discomfort for the infant. The Unistik Heelstik devices solely target surface blood vessels, preventing them from penetrating deeply enough to impact skin pain fibers.

What Regional Trends Are Shaping Growth In The Capillary Blood Collection Devices Market?
North America was the largest region in the capillary blood collection devices market in 2024. Asia-Pacific is expected to be the fastest-growing region in the forecast period. The regions covered in the capillary blood collection devices market report are Asia-Pacific, Western Europe, Eastern Europe, North America, South America, Middle East, Africa.
